We offer both solutions to match your production scale and budget. Fully automatic rigid box making machines are complete, integrated lines for high-volume, consistent output with minimal labor. Semi-automatic units are individual machines (like gluers or corner pasters) ideal for specific process upgrades, lower-volume production, or as a flexible starting point for automation.
